Market Challenges and Restraints
Despite its growth prospects, the South Korea VMA market faces several challenges that could temper expansion. Cost remains a significant barrier, especially for smaller firms with limited budgets, as advanced admixture formulations tend to be premium-priced. Regulatory complexities related to material standards and environmental compliance can also impede rapid adoption, requiring ongoing certification and testing processes.
Infrastructure limitations, such as supply chain disruptions or logistical bottlenecks, may hinder timely distribution of VMA products across diverse regions. Competitive pressures from alternative admixture solutions and traditional construction materials further constrain market penetration. Additionally, the need for continuous innovation to meet evolving industry standards necessitates substantial R&D investments, which could pose financial and operational challenges for market players.
- High product costs limiting adoption among smaller firms
- Regulatory hurdles related to environmental and safety standards
- Supply chain and logistical constraints impacting distribution
- Intense competition from alternative admixture products
- Need for ongoing innovation to meet industry standards
